Urška Klakočar Zupančič has announced her departure from Slovenian politics following the election outcome in the Ljubljana Center district. The announcement, made on Facebook, details her intention to dedicate herself to independent external political activities. Preliminary results show Ms.
Klakočar Zupančič garnered 3,893 votes within the district. Speaking from the Freedom Movement’s headquarters, she expressed satisfaction with the party’s performance based on these initial figures. During her tenure as a representative, Klakočar Zupančič highlighted the reforms implemented during the previous term, noting their positive effects.
She confirmed her decision to conclude her career in elected office, transitioning to a new role focused on broader political engagement.
